技术文摘
浅论 Web 自适应
浅论 Web 自适应
在当今数字化时代,Web 自适应已成为网站设计和开发中至关重要的一环。随着各种设备的普及,如智能手机、平板电脑、笔记本电脑以及台式电脑等,用户访问网站的方式变得越来越多样化。一个能够自适应不同屏幕尺寸和设备类型的网站,能够提供更好的用户体验,从而增加用户的满意度和忠诚度。
Web 自适应的核心目标是确保网站的内容在各种设备上都能够以最佳的方式呈现。这意味着无论是在小屏幕的手机上,还是在大屏幕的电脑显示器上,用户都能够轻松地浏览、阅读和与网站进行交互。实现 Web 自适应并非易事,它需要综合考虑多个方面的因素。
响应式布局是 Web 自适应的关键技术之一。通过使用灵活的网格系统和相对单位,如百分比和 em,网站的布局能够根据屏幕的大小自动调整。例如,在大屏幕上可以显示多列内容,而在小屏幕上则可以自动切换为单列布局,以确保内容的可读性和可用性。
图片和多媒体元素的处理也至关重要。为了适应不同的网络速度和设备性能,图片应该能够自动调整大小和分辨率。对于视频等多媒体内容,也需要提供不同的格式和码率,以保证在各种设备上的流畅播放。
另外,字体的选择和排版也需要适应不同的屏幕尺寸。在小屏幕上,应该使用较大的字体和适当的行间距,以提高阅读的舒适度。而在大屏幕上,则可以更加注重字体的风格和排版的美感。
Web 自适应还需要考虑到用户的交互方式。在触摸屏设备上,按钮和链接应该足够大,以便用户能够轻松点击。同时,导航菜单的设计也应该简洁明了,方便用户在不同设备上进行操作。
最后,性能优化也是 Web 自适应不可忽视的一部分。优化代码、减少 HTTP 请求、缓存资源等措施能够加快网站的加载速度,提升用户体验。
Web 自适应是一个复杂但必要的领域,它需要设计师、开发人员和内容创作者的共同努力。通过精心的规划和实施,能够打造出一个在各种设备上都表现出色的网站,为用户提供优质的服务和体验,从而在竞争激烈的网络世界中脱颖而出。
- 内嵌CSS样式在审查元素时显示为空的原因
- Vue 项目运用 ClickHouse JS 实现增删改查操作的方法
- 鼠标移动使动态元素消失,源码位置如何定位
- 前端实现可编辑Excel导出方案的方法
- 正则表达式匹配含引号的script标签内容方法
- Visual Studio Code折叠代码后完整复制所有代码的方法
- Vue Router 的 index.js 文件中为何要注册 VueRouter
- HTML中Ruby标签间有间隔的解决方法
- ECharts中点击图表复制X轴值的方法
- HTML结构中子元素数量不定时如何选取第一个特定子元素
- 怎样控制元素背景图的缩放中心
- 若依框架标签页切换致页面重载,筛选条件重置问题怎么解决
- 复制折叠状态下Visual Studio Code代码的方法
- 怎样运用 flex 或 grid 布局让 HTML 元素呈现指定排列效果
- React中useState在异步代码中不能更新的原因